Daniel Shao (flute) & Daniel King-Smith (piano)

Our February concert was full of good things from flautist Daniel Shao and his accompanist Daniel King-Smith. An assured and gripping performance brought us some of the greatest flute music, opening with a Bach Sonata and followed by a complete contrast, Bartok’s vibrant Hungarian Peasant Suite . Lensky’s Aria (Tchaikowsky) had all the singing cantabile required and Hamilton Harty’s ‘In Ireland’ came across with compelling Irish charm. Poulenc’s great Flute Sonata was performed with tremendous dynamic contrasts and a magnificently fast final movement. More beauty and charm came with Schubert and Gluck and then Prokofiev’s Flute Sonata had all the fire and excitement needed to bring the evening to a powerful and brilliant close.
